Jančíková M, Světnička M, Kodytková A, David J. Approach to a patient with suspected mental anorexia

Mental anorexia is most common in adolescent girls and young women, but can affect individuals of any age, gender, sexual orientation or any socio-economic level. Although it is a serious disease, some patients may have a completely physiological finding on clinical physical examination. Early diagnosis is essential and requires a multidisciplinary approach. Tunnel vision must be avoided and other possible organic causes properly ruled out. As part of the therapeutic approach, it should be borne in mind that the disease is not the result of patient choice and it is therefore advisable to take a non-sanctioned and motivating approach. Mental anorexia requires interdisciplinary cooperation and belongs to the field of pedopsychiatry, with the need for cooperation with a psychologist. A full recovery is possible, however, it is often lengthy and accompanied by a number of relapses.

The presented article discusses the approach to a patient with suspected mental anorexia, including etiopathogenesis, clinical and paraclinical findings, diagnosis and treatment from the perspective of outpatient and hospital paediatrics.
